The only place matrotropy shows up online is in her article.  I think she
meant matrotrophy... which doesn't mean "eating the mother" at all.  It
means "grown/nourished by the mother" and is, indeed, a term used by
biologists.  However, it is used to describe embryos that receive
nourishment from the mother throughout gestation... as contrasted to, say,
embryos that develop fully from the yolk inside an egg (called
"lecithotrophy").
